Oxford Biotherapeutics is a clinical-stage biotechnology company focusing on the development of antibody therapeutics for the treatment of cancer. OBT’s OGAP-verify® platform is the world's largest, cancer specific, membrane protein library, directly measuring plasma membrane protein expression in patient tumors. OGAP is used to identify novel, highly tumor specific antigens for novel first-in-class ADC, T-cell Engager (TCE) and Chimeric Antigen Receptor (CAR-T) targets.
Our lead asset, OBT
076, is an Antibody Drug Conjugate (ADC) in Phase 1b clinical development. Our clinical and pre-clinical pipeline of novel biologics is balanced between internal programs, focused on ADCs and checkpoint regulators, and externally partnered programs with key innovators in oncology such as Roche, GSK and Zymeworks.
